SENSITIVE INFORMATION 

 

Sensitive Information is defined in the Privacy Act to include information or opinion about such things as an individual's racial or ethnic origin, political opinions, membership of a political association, religious or philosophical beliefs, membership of a trade union or other professional body, criminal record or health information. 

Sensitive information will be used by us only: 

  • For the primary purpose for which it was obtained 

  • For a secondary purpose that is directly related to the primary purpose 

  • With your consent; or where required or authorised by law.

COOKIES AND PIXELS 

A cookie is a small file placed in your web browser that collects information about your web browsing behaviour. Use of cookies allows a website to tailor its configuration to your needs and preferences. Cookies do not access information stored on your computer or any Personal Information (e.g. name, address, email address or telephone number). Most web browsers automatically accept cookies but you can choose to reject cookies by changing your browser settings. This may, however, prevent you from taking full advantage of our website.
